What You Should Know About Individual Health Insurance

Saturday, October 31st, 2009

While many people believe that individual health insurance is only for persons that do not qualify for group coverage, some individuals may find that individual plans may be a better option for your health care.

Young and healthy people will often pay less on an individual plan that they would for a group plan. When you are under age forty and in good health, this is often true. Once you pass age forty, individual plans become more expensive than group plans. If you must pay for your own insurance and qualify, you may want to begin with an individual plan and then move to a group plan. If your employer pays for the plan, then you may want to look at an individual plan for your family.

After you reach age forty, you will find that individual plans cost more than most individual plans than it would cost for a group plan.

If you have health problems, you may not qualify for individual plans, but group plans must accept you. Many states have assigned risk pools that can provide individual insurance for you. The cost for this coverage may be more, but you will be able to get the coverage you need in order to qualify for the medical care that is needed.

One way to save on the cost of insurance premiums is to have higher deductibles. This does mean that you will have to pay more if you do need to use the insurance If you have to go to the hospital, this option may end up costing you more than if you had gone ahead and paid for the higher premiums and lower deductibles. It pays to calculate these costs before you choose the insurance policy you buy.

If you do not have employer provided health insurance, the an individual health insurance plan is a much better option than having medical bills that you are unable to pay.

Group Health Insurance For Small And Large Companies

Saturday, October 31st, 2009

Group health insurance is when an employer is able to offer health insurance to eligible employees as a benefit for working with that company. Most employees in the US get their health insurance in this way.

The type of coverage your company receives as well as the premium rates will differ depending on what state you are in as well as the size of the company. Small employers and large employers have different policies with different regulations and rules.

Small employee group health insurance must provide health insurance to everyone even if they have a pre-existing condition. This type of insurance is also known as guaranteed insurance. Small employer insurance must be renewed each year. While the insurer must accept all employees they can review employee’s medical health and change the policy when it is renewed to not provide coverage for certain health issues.

The insurance companies tend to use medical underwriting to determine the insurance premium rates. Some insurance companies may also use community rating or modified community rating to determine the premium rates. Medical underwriting again uses your medial history to determine the coverage for each company’s insurance policy.

Large employers do not have a guaranteed issue requirement so an insurance company can reject a large company based on its past medical claims. However if you are an employee and eligible for benefits you cannot be excluded from the group insurance policy even if you have a pre-existing condition.

Large company group insurance policies will set rates and premiums based on the companies prior claims and which employees tend to participate in the health insurance program. Large companies do not require medical history or health questionnaire.

Advice on Buying Individual Health Insurance at a Group Rate

Friday, October 30th, 2009

Group health insurance, as part of a group plan at a full-time job, is generally offered at lower rates on premiums compared to individual health insurance coverage. But if you leave your job – or start another one that doesn’t offer health insurance, a group health plan may not be an option. And you may be surprised at just how expensive the same coverage is when you buy individual health insurance.

While individual health insurance plans are purchased directly from carriers, leaving out the employer middle man, they do not offer the fuller range of benefits and lower rates associated with the typical workplace group plan. However, individual plans may cover you, your spouse, and your children. The two other main methods to get an individual health insurance plan when you’re not fully employed with a group health plan are to obtain either “short-term” and/or “catastrophic” coverage.

“Medically underwritten” individual plans allow the insurer to reject your application or attach exclusions to your policy if you have a “prior existing condition”. So there is no guarantee that an insurer will accept you for an individual policy. Under “Guaranteed Issue” laws, some states require that health insurance carriers issue you a policy, no matter what medical problems you have. Do your homework and check the list of “Guaranteed Issue” laws for your state. The Kaiser Family Foundation has published a list of these laws.

Individual plan buyers pay premiums determined by their “expected” health care costs, so prices will be higher as they grow older and/or less healthy. But don’t let any confusion tempt you to go without health insurance. Healthy or not, you could have a serious accident, and, as many others are, be forced into “medical bankruptcy.”

So don’t lose your rights to coverage of pre-existing conditions. Don’t go without insurance for 63 days or more, a time period set by the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A).

You may feel locked out of the health insurance market if, for example, you’ve been uninsured for too long, or have a “pre-existing condition”. It may seem impossible, there are practical ways you may be able to get coverage.

If you are a self-employed, sole proprietor, even home-based, you need to do your research carefully. Because in some states, you can be eligible to buy health insurance as a “group of one”. All you need is proof that you’ve been in business for at least 30 days.

Do some research to find out if you qualify for a group rate, even if you live in a state that does not offer these “group of one” insurance policies. For example, if you own a business, even a home-based business, and have at least one partner or employee, even your spouse who may be doing secretarial work for you; this situation qualifies you as a two-person business, eligible for a group-rate policy.

Before planning to leave an employer with which you have a group health plan, call and inquire as to whether their insurance carrier can convert it to an individual health plan for you. Even though the rate will be higher than your employer’s group plan, it’s your best option, for the time being, to secure health insurance. This is most important for those with existing medical conditions. Also inquire as to whether your spouse has a group plan at their work, and if they can add you on.
